May 2025 - Apr 2026Bury Lane area has the 3rd highest crime rate of 28 local areas in Penn & Mill End , and the 25th highest crime rate of 277 local areas in Three Rivers .
Neighbouring streets tend to have noticeably higher crime levels than this postcode. Crime here is lower than the average for the surrounding output areas.
The overall crime rate in the area around Bury Lane (WD3 1DN) in the last 12 months was 133.6 per 1,000 residents and was 91.3% higher than the Penn & Mill End average (69.8 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 10 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Theft from the person 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Violent crimes ( -28.6%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 10 (≈ 38.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-28.6%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-28.0%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Bury Lane (WD3 1DN), the main crime hotspot is near Parking Area. Police recorded 150 crimes here, including 50 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
